WBC welterweight champion Floyd Mayweather Jr. has promised his fans to display his aggressive side against Miguel Cotto on May 5 at the MGM Grand Arena in Las Vegas. Miguel Cotto will defend his World Boxing Association junior middleweight title in this
fight.
Both the fighters were present in Manila, Philippines to promote their fight. When asked about his fighting style, Mayweather iterated, “Am I going to be in a very, very aggressive style? I believe so.”
He further added, “I just have to see how the fight plays out, but I'm going to approach it in a very, very aggressive way and go out there and press the attack early.”
Mayweather currently stands with 42 wins, 0 losses and 26 knockouts in his portfolio. He remains undefeated to date and chances are that he will extend his streak after beating Cotto, as most analysts put it. Mayweather, throughout his career, has displayed
his defensive side, for which he is known worldwide. He is the master of defence in the ring when it comes to boxing. However, this time he says it will be a bit different. He added, “As you can see in my last fight, as each round went on, I started throwing
more and more combinations because I feel that every fighter comes out strong the first, second and third round. But there's nine more.”
Mayweather’s last fight was against Victor Ortiz in September last year, in which he dominated Ortiz very well. Keeping in mind Cotto’s two previous knockouts – against Antonio Margarito and Manny Pacquiao – Mayweather thinks it will be easier for him to
beat Cotto with aggression rather than defence.
He further added that he thinks if a guy has been knocked out once, he fears it can happen again which is the main reason as to why he (Mayweather) thinks he can knockout Cotto. He then said he is faster and a better counter-puncher than Cotto which gives
him an edge over Cotto.
Most analysts have rated Miguel Cotto was the underdog for this mega-fight, since they think Cotto is not tough enough against Mayweather.
